I applied via Referral and was interviewed in Jun 2023. There were 3 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Resume Shortlist 
Pro Tip by AmbitionBox:
Keep your resume crisp and to the point. A recruiter looks at your resume for an average of 6 seconds, make sure to leave the best impression.
View all tips
Round 2 - Technical 

(3 Questions)

  • Q1. Basics of c++ and C
  • Q2. Basics of compilation stages
  • Q3. Basic of memory layouting
Round 3 - Technical 

(3 Questions)

  • Q1. Introduction of their project
  • Q2. Breif introduction by me on my current project
  • Q3. Basic of QT and QML

Interview Preparation Tips

Interview preparation tips for other job seekers - prepare well for the topics mentioned in your JD.
most question will be based on the concepts of JD.
Basics of C and C++.They check for concepts well understood

I applied via LinkedIn and was interviewed in Dec 2021. There were 2 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Technical 

(1 Question)

  • Q1. - Explain product architecture - database patterns - NFRs - OOPS concepts, advanced .NET concepts
Round 2 - Technical 

(1 Question)

  • Q1. - Agile, scrum - how to resolve conflict within a team - SAFe - Integrations across services - Microservices patterns

Interview Preparation Tips

Interview preparation tips for other job seekers - I applied via online job portal and received call on Jan, 2022. Since then, I had 6 rounds of interview as detailed below:
- Technical round 1X1 - mainly product architecture.
- Senior Architect technical round - process/agile/scrum etc.
- Principle Architect/Engineer (from down under) - decent discussion, engineer himself has joined 6 months back.
- Senior/Hiring Manager
- Principle Engineer (again from down-under)
- Group discussion with Hiring Manager (Ukraine) and another principle engineer.

Overall duration: 4 months
Status: Not accepted.

Observations:
- Absolute poorly managed hiring process. HRs are clueless about next rounds/processes or who will be taking the round.
- I have joined interviews thrice (yes thrice) where interviewer did not join! and I kept on waiting on call.
- On an average, 1 round per month.
- The technical discussions with Aussie counterpart was a delight. They were sensitive and apologized for such inordinate delays.
- Indian (unfortunately) interviewers barring one, was listless, on a hurry and had a little impression on me.

Verdict:
Never again.
